Bugs, Porky Et Al. Together At Last

In what may seem a lot like taking money out of one pocket and putting it into another, the Cartoon Network, a cable outlet owned by Time Warner, has made an exclusive deal with Warner Bros., also owned by Time Warner, to become the exclusive outlet for the Looney Tunes animated comedy shorts beginning next fall.

The Looney Tunes library contains nearly 900 shorts featuring such classic characters as Bugs Bunny, Daffy Duck, Porky Pig, Elmer Fudd, Yosemite Sam, Sylvester, Tweety, Road Runner, Wile E. Coyote, Foghorn Leghorn, Pepe Le Pew, Speedy Gonzales, Marvin the Martian and The Tasmanian Devil. In a statement, Betty Cohen, president of Cartoon Network, said: "The Looney Tunes are both the most influential and most valuable property in all of animation. They're what people think of first when they hear the word 'cartoon.'"
